Basic Concepts

Turbine housings in turbochargers are integral to the engine system, serving as the conduit for exhaust gases exiting the engine. These gases spin the turbine wheel, which is connected to the compressor wheel via a shaft. The compressor wheel then forces more air into the engine, allowing for more fuel to be burned and thus increasing power output. The efficiency of this process is influenced by the design and material of the turbine housing 2.

Maintenance and Troubleshooting

Regular maintenance of the Housing, Turbine HT3B is important for ensuring its continued performance and durability. This includes inspecting the housing for signs of wear, damage, or leaks, and cleaning it to remove any buildup that could affect its efficiency. Common issues to watch for include cracks or warping due to thermal stress, and troubleshooting may involve checking for proper fitment and ensuring that the turbocharger system is operating within its designed parameters.
